Candidate will be responsible for maintaining, adjusting, isolating, removing and replacing faulty hardware on full motion Operational Flight Trainers (OFTs) and Avionics Desk-Top Trainers (AVDTTs) that support the Combat Rescue Helicopter (CRH) training program. Candidate will perform scheduled and unscheduled maintenance on host computers, image generators, visual displays, input/output (I/O), electric/hydraulic control loading systems, electric/hydraulic motion systems, computer networks, and associated electronics. Candidate will report and document all hardware system actions related to equipment malfunctions, modifications, removal, installation, fault isolation, and repair. Candidate will perform operational checkouts and preventive maintenance utilizing work instructions and technical manuals. Candidate will complete On-the-Job (OJT) training requirements/program as directed by ICS Manager and/or CLS Maintenance Manager. Candidate will complete maintenance data collection records on equipment associated with trainer and support equipment. He/she will perform additional duties as directed by the management team. Duties may include bench stock, tools (CTK), test equipment, Air Force Technical Order (AFTO) 781 forms, etc. Candidate will attend meetings as directed by management. Candidate will establish and maintain positive and courteous relationships with all military and civilian personnel related to this program. He/she will support modification to trainers as directed by management and comply with all site safety and security policies and procedures. Candidate will complete all assigned tasks with quality, pride, and ownership in mind. Candidate will demonstrate strong attention to detail in every aspect of daily taskings. Applicants selected will be subject to a government security investigation and must meet eligibility requirements for access to classified information. US Citizenship is required. Candidate must have an Interim Secret DoD Security Clearance prior to starting this position.

Requirements

  • Field engineer on other related training systems
  • Strong background (over 4 years) of PC based computer repair
  • Can design, implement, test, and maintain system hardware as required with engineering support and government testing
  • Support sub-contractors with technical knowledge of system operation and design during modification and testing
  • Complete understanding of Request for Drawing Change (RFDAs) process
  • Able to write, review and update Contractor Operating Instructions' (COIs) and Work Instructions (WIs) related to the maintenance section.
  • Strong working knowledge of Maintenance Data Collection (MDC) database
  • Understanding of CLS metrics and Key Performance Indicators (KPI's)
  • Skilled with Microsoft Office, Word, Excel, Access and PowerPoint.
  • Skilled in use of simple software commands to support fault isolation
  • Understand, speak, read, and write English
  • Able to lift over 25 LBS
  • Able to work at height's above 10 feet
  • Able to obtain an Interim secret security clearance prior to starting this position.
  • US Citizenship is required. Candidate must be able to obtain an Interim DoD Secret Security Clearance prior to starting this position.
  • Security + certification required
